U.S. Civil War - U.S. Army

Conrad Schmidt

Details
  • Rank: First Sergeant (Highest Rank: Quartermaster Sergeant)
  • Conflict/Era: U.S. Civil War
  • Unit/Command:
    Company K,
    2d U.S. Cavalry
  • Military Service Branch: U.S. Army
  • Medal of Honor Action Date: September 19, 1864
  • Medal of Honor Action Place: Winchester, Virginia, USA
Citation
Went to the assistance of his regimental commander, whose horse had been killed under him in a charge, mounted the officer behind him, under a heavy fire from the enemy, and returned him to his command.
Additional Details
  • Accredited to: Fort Leavenworth, Leavenworth County, Kansas
  • Awarded Posthumously: No
  • Presentation Date & Details: March 16, 1896
  • Born: February 27, 1830, Wurttemberg, Germany
  • Died: December 26, 1908, Junction City, KS, United States
  • Buried: Catholic Cemetery (MH) (NE corner) , Ogden, KS, United States
